Vacuolar H(+)-ATPase Activity Is Required for Endocytic and Secretory Trafficking in Arabidopsis
In eukaryotic cells, compartments of the highly dynamic endomembrane system are acidified to varying degrees by the activity of vacuolar H(+)-ATPases (V-ATPases).
